Above, we had a great year! 2017 highlights, clockwise from upper left, the first public visits to Race Rock Light, a performance about Augustin Fresnel, and a 2nd LIS Lighthouse Conference were among our 2017 lighthouse offerings; educational programs included our 3rd-grade local history program with NL Public Schools, a concert series, Steve Jones's ferry tour of Fishers Island Sound, and a dowsing workshop; Day photojournalists, Byron Huart, and David Zapatka exhibited their work at the Custom House; preservation efforts at the museum included rebuilding four lower-level windows and beginning plans to restore the custom house roof; our trustees celebrated NLMS's 34th year; work at Harbor Light included creating an opening in the lighthouse wall; architect Paul Farrell talked tugs and Thames towboats brought two to the waterfront for us to tour; collections now include a 1761 newspaper announcing the
 lottery to construct Harbor Lighthouse - Long Island Sound's first.
   
We truly miss the friends we lost this year: Bob Landry, who created 3 amazing 
lighthouses, trustees Jeff  Harris, Peggy Peters, and long-time supporter &  honorary trustee Sarah Steffian.
